How they compare
Lithuania currently reports 34,846 current US$ against 32,258 current US$ in Saint Lucia, a difference of 2,588 current US$.
That makes Lithuania's figure about 1.1 times Saint Lucia's.
The two have swapped places 1 time across 26 shared years of data; in 1995 it was Saint Lucia ahead.
Lithuania ranks 38th and Saint Lucia ranks 39th of 150 countries.
Across the 4 decades both report, Lithuania averaged higher in 2 and Saint Lucia in 2.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Lithuania | Saint Lucia |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1990s | 13,132 current US$ | 23,829 current US$ | 10,697 current US$ | Saint Lucia |
| 2000s | 24,651 current US$ | 29,745 current US$ | 5,094 current US$ | Saint Lucia |
| 2010s | 29,185 current US$ | 24,890 current US$ | 4,295 current US$ | Lithuania |
| 2020s | 34,846 current US$ | 32,258 current US$ | 2,587 current US$ | Lithuania |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
